Output 5bd8e50607136fc0d8e417dc162edb0b84c72ddfb7649d4def59c7a0522d38ae:10

value
905362
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b9a98174265b4eb7c99a7b7c0f3b67e750f51309 OP_EQUAL
address
3JchzVa3y91k7Rw3FPdV1d8zmRWhhVaM53
transaction
5bd8e50607136fc0d8e417dc162edb0b84c72ddfb7649d4def59c7a0522d38ae
spent
true